Comprised of a specially modified DET-250 tractor and a semitrailer excavating unit, the ETR-254 excavator is the first continuous-action machine designed to excavate trenches with a main pipeline diameter of 1420 mm, in soils up to the fifth group inclusive, and also in soils frozen to 1.5 meters. The trailer chassis is joined to the tractor in a novel way by pins located in the middle part of the treads, ensuring uniform distribution of tread pressure on the ground in both the excavating and the highway position. The new excavator (Industrial Model Certificate 1011, Bulletin of Inventions, 1970, No. 29) has been recommended for mass production.
